Your California rights
Medical information under HIPAA and the California Confidentiality of Medical Information Act is exempt from the California Consumer Privacy Act. For the information we hold outside your medical record, we will honor your right to know what we have collected, to request deletion or correction, to opt out of any sale or sharing, which we do not do, and not to be treated differently for asking. Write to hello@apsarawomenshealth.com and we will verify your identity before responding.
Under California Civil Code Section 1798.83, you may ask about disclosures to third parties for their direct marketing. We do not make any.
